Modern human brain originated in Africa around 1.7 million years ago

The human brain as we all know it right this moment is comparatively younger. It developed about 1.7 million years ago when the tradition of stone instruments in Africa grew to become more and more advanced. A short while later, the brand new Homo populations unfold to Southeast Asia, researchers from the College of Zurich have now proven utilizing computed tomography analyses of fossilized skulls.

Modern people are basically totally different from our closest residing kin, the good apes: We reside on the bottom, stroll on two legs and have a lot bigger brains. The primary populations of the genus Homo emerged in Africa about 2.5 million years ago. They already walked upright, however their brains had been solely about half the dimensions of right this moment’s people. These earliest Homo populations in Africa had primitive ape-like brains—identical to their extinct ancestors, the australopithecines. So when and the place did the everyday human brain evolve?

CT comparisons of skulls reveal trendy brain constructions

A global staff led by Christoph Zollikofer and Marcia Ponce de León from the Division of Anthropology on the College of Zurich (UZH) has now succeeded in answering these questions. “Our analyses recommend that trendy human brain constructions emerged only one.5 to 1.7 million years ago in African Homo populations,” Zollikofer says. The researchers used computed tomography to look at the skulls of Homo fossils that lived in Africa and Asia 1 to 2 million years ago. They then in contrast the fossil knowledge with reference knowledge from nice apes and people.

Aside from the dimensions, the human brain differs from that of the good apes significantly in the situation and group of particular person brain areas. “The options typical to people are primarily these areas in the frontal lobe which might be chargeable for planning and executing advanced patterns of thought and motion, and finally additionally for language,” notes first writer Marcia Ponce de León. Since these areas are considerably bigger in the human brain, the adjoining brain areas shifted additional again.

Typical human brain unfold quickly from Africa to Asia

The primary Homo populations exterior Africa—in Dmanisi in what’s now Georgia—had brains that had been simply as primitive as their African kin. It follows, due to this fact, that the brains of early people didn’t change into significantly giant or significantly trendy till around 1.7 million years ago. Nevertheless, these early people had been fairly able to making quite a few instruments, adapting to the brand new environmental situations of Eurasia, creating animal meals sources, and caring for group members in want of assist.

Throughout this era, the cultures in Africa grew to become extra advanced and numerous, as evidenced by the invention of assorted forms of stone instruments. The researchers suppose that organic and cultural evolution are in all probability interdependent. “It’s possible that the earliest types of human language additionally developed throughout this era,” says anthropologist Ponce de León. Fossils discovered on Java present proof that the brand new populations had been extraordinarily profitable: Shortly after their first look in Africa, they’d already unfold to Southeast Asia.

Brain imprints in fossil skulls reveal evolution of people

Earlier theories had little to assist them due to the shortage of dependable knowledge. “The issue is that the brains of our ancestors weren’t preserved as fossils. Their brain constructions can solely be deduced from impressions left by the folds and furrows on the inside surfaces of fossil skulls,” says examine chief Zollikofer. As a result of these imprints fluctuate significantly from particular person to particular person, till now it was not potential to obviously decide whether or not a specific Homo fossil had a extra ape-like or a extra human-like brain. Utilizing computed tomography analyses of a spread of fossil skulls, the researchers have now been capable of shut this hole for the primary time.
